什么是全局服务器负载平衡
-
全局服务器负载平衡指的是通过将网络流量分配到多个服务器上,以提高系统性能和可靠性的一种技术。它是一种网络管理策略,通过均衡地分配网络请求和负载,确保每台服务器都能有效地处理请求,同时避免某台服务器过载。全局服务器负载平衡能够实现高可用性、可扩展性和灵活性,可以提供更好的用户体验和系统性能。
全局服务器负载平衡的工作原理是将请求流量从客户端分发到多台服务器上。这可以通过多种方式实现,其中一种常见的是基于DNS的负载均衡。在这种情况下,负载均衡器作为中间人,接收客户端的请求并将其转发到最适合的服务器上。负载均衡器使用一系列算法来决定哪个服务器能够最有效地处理请求,例如基于轮询、加权轮询、最小连接数等。
全局服务器负载平衡有许多优势。首先,它可以提高系统的可用性,当一台服务器发生故障时,负载均衡器可以自动将流量转发到其他健康的服务器上,确保系统继续正常运行。其次,负载均衡可以实现请求的智能分配,确保每台服务器都能均衡地处理请求,避免某台服务器过载。另外,全局服务器负载平衡还可以提供有效的资源利用和可扩展性,使系统能够处理更多的并发请求。
在实践中,全局服务器负载平衡可以与其他技术和策略结合使用,以实现更高级别的性能和可靠性。例如,可以将负载均衡与缓存系统、故障转移技术和内容分发网络(CDN)等结合使用,以进一步提升系统的性能和可靠性。
总而言之,全局服务器负载平衡是一种通过将网络流量均衡地分配到多台服务器上,以提高系统性能和可靠性的技术。它可以实现高可用性、可扩展性和灵活性,提供更好的用户体验和系统性能。
1年前 -
全局服务器负载平衡(Global Server Load Balancing,GSLB)是一种用于分发网络流量和资源的技术,用于管理和平衡跨多个地理位置的服务器集群的负载。它确保了网络流量的高可用性、可伸缩性和可靠性,以提供更好的用户体验。
下面是关于全局服务器负载平衡的五个重要点:
-
跨地理位置的负载均衡:全局服务器负载平衡通过将流量分配到位于不同地理位置的服务器集群上,实现了负载的均衡。这样可以确保用户请求被发送到最近的、具有最快响应时间的服务器上,从而提高用户体验。同时,如果其中某个服务器失效,负载平衡器可以自动将流量重定向到其他健康的服务器上。
-
健康检查和故障检测:全局服务器负载平衡器会定期向服务器发送健康检查请求,以确保服务器正常工作。如果服务器未能响应,负载平衡器会将其标记为不可用,并将流量转移到其他可用的服务器上。这样可以提供高可用性和容错性,并确保用户不会遇到服务器故障带来的问题。
-
优化资源利用和性能:全局服务器负载平衡可以根据服务器的负载情况和性能指标动态地分配流量,以优化资源利用和提高系统性能。如果某台服务器的负载较高,负载平衡器可以将更少的流量分配给它,以保持系统的稳定性。而当某台服务器的负载较低时,负载平衡器可以将更多的流量分配给它,以最大程度地利用其资源。
-
数据中心间的负载均衡:全局服务器负载平衡可以实现不同数据中心之间的负载均衡,这对于跨地域或跨国企业尤为重要。通过将用户请求分配到不同数据中心的服务器上,可以实现跨地理位置的负载均衡和故障恢复。这样可以提高系统的可用性和可靠性,并降低单点故障的风险。
-
可扩展性和灵活性:全局服务器负载平衡具有很强的可扩展性和灵活性。当服务器集群的规模增大或缩小时,负载平衡器可以自动调整流量分配策略,保持负载均衡。同时,它还可以处理不同类型的流量分发需求,如基于地理位置、用户IP地址、HTTP头等进行流量分配,以满足不同场景的需求。
总之,全局服务器负载平衡是一种关键的网络技术,用于确保网络流量的高可用性、可伸缩性和可靠性。它通过跨多个地理位置分发流量、健康检查和故障检测、优化资源利用和性能、数据中心间的负载均衡以及可扩展性和灵活性等机制,为用户提供优质的网络体验,并保护服务器免受故障和攻击的影响。
1年前 -
-
全局服务器负责平衡(Global Server Load Balancing,GSLB)是一种网络技术,用于将传入的网络流量分配到多个服务器,以实现高可用性和高性能的服务。GSLB可以实现对服务器的动态监控和管理,根据不同的负载状况和用户地理位置,将用户请求发送到最优的服务器上。它可以在不同的地理位置和网络环境下,实现全局范围内的负载均衡和故障转移。
下面是全局服务器负载平衡的具体方法和操作流程。
-
域名解析
首先,需要将域名解析配置指向全局服务器负载平衡器。用户在浏览器中输入域名,DNS服务器将返回负载平衡器的IP地址作为解析结果。 -
流量分发
当用户发起请求时,流量会被定向到全局服务器负载平衡器。负载平衡器会根据一系列算法,如Round Robin(轮询)、Least Connection(最小连接数)或基于性能的算法,将流量分发给后端的多个服务器。 -
健康检查
全局服务器负载平衡器会定期对后端服务器进行健康检查,以确保它们处于正常工作状态。检查的方式可以是发送TCP、HTTP或ICMP请求,然后根据响应结果来判断服务器的健康状态。如果某个服务器未能通过健康检查,负载平衡器将不再将流量分发给该服务器,直至其恢复正常。 -
监视与管理
负载平衡器可以通过监视服务器的负载情况、带宽利用率、延迟等指标,来实时监控服务器的性能。根据实际情况,可以调整流量分发策略,以优化服务器的资源利用和用户体验。 -
故障转移与容错
当某个服务器宕机或无法正常工作时,全局服务器负载平衡器可以将用户请求转发到其他正常工作的服务器上,以保证服务的连续性和可用性。这种故障转移可以在几秒钟内完成,对用户来说几乎是无感知的。 -
地理位置策略
根据用户的地理位置,全局服务器负载平衡器可以将请求分发到最接近用户的服务器上,以降低延迟和提高访问速度。这可以通过地理位置数据库或者用户IP地址的地理位置信息来实现。
总结:
全局服务器负载平衡是通过将流量分发到多个服务器来提高服务的可用性和性能。它可以实现动态监控和管理服务器、根据不同负载状况和地理位置分发流量、故障转移和容错等功能。这种负载平衡方法可以在全球范围内实现高效的流量调度,提高系统的可用性和用户体验。1年前 -